Adams -- Weber Wed

Sunday, August 27, 2006

Jessica Adams and Donovan Weber were married July 15, 2006, at The Marjorie Powell Allen Chapel at Powell Gardens, Kingsville, Mo. Sarah Knoll-Williams, Episcopal seminary student, Berkeley, Calif., celebrated the nuptials with the Honorable David Darnold, Nevada, in attendance.

The processional selection, "Ava Maria" was performed by violinist, Melody Adams, sister-in-law of the bride, Carrollton, Texas. Acoustic guitarists, Dave Bush, St. Louis, and Phillip Johnson, Liberty, played "The Luckiest" and "It's a Wonderful World." Readings included the "Traditional Irish Blessing" by the bride's sister-in-law, Amy Adams, Columbia, and the "Traditional Jewish Blessing" by the groom's sister, Shay Weber-Lewis, Kansas City. Following the ceremony, guests were transported by trolley to the Powell Gardens Grand Hall and Conservatory for a cocktail buffet and dance reception.

The bride is the daughter of Jim and Rama Adams, Nevada. The groom is the son of Mark and Randi Weber, Kansas City, and grandson of Seymour and Shirley Zeinfeld, Overland Park, Kan.

Angela Scalese, Kansas City, who introduced the couple at a birthday party in 2000, served as matron of honor. Sarah Scherder, Bowling Green, Mo., was maid of honor. Brody Weber, brother of the groom, Kansas City, served as best man, and Kenneth Barr, Kansas City, was groomsman. Ring bearer was Benjamin Adams, Carrollton, Texas, nephew of the bride. Ushers were Matt Knoll-Willams, Berkeley, Calif., and brothers of the bride, Jeremy Adams, Carrollton, Texas, and Joshua Adams, Columbia, Mo.

Reception attendants, cousins of the bride, were Katlyn Kern, Brooke Kuehny, Kate Sontheimer, Sarah Morgan and Erin and Shannon Tuttle. Friends of the couple, Dominick Scalese, and Brian Scherder, served as videographer and disc jockey, respectively.

Following a wedding trip to Michigan's Upper Peninsula, the couple was greeted at a brunch reception at the Nevada Country Club July 30, 2006. Music was provided by pianist, Janice Runyan, and violinist, Melody Adams. The newlyweds are at home in Columbia where they attend the University of Missouri. Jessica is majoring in civil engineering and Donovan, in architectural studies.
